Hillsboro Police Report
On Aug. 20, Andrew Huffman of Hillsboro, driving a 1997 Dodge, was traveling northbound on North High Street when he failed to stop for a 2001 Ford that was turning left onto Somers Street and was driven by Angela Williams of Hillsboro. Huffman was cited for assured clear distance. Williams and a passenger in her vehicle were transported to Highland District Hospital by the Hillsboro Life Squad.

Karen McBee of Peebles, driving a 2007 Chevrolet, was traveling westbound on East Main Street and struck a 2007 Chevrolet that was stopped in traffic and was driven by Ethel Bursk of Hillsboro. Light damage was received by both vehicles.
The department received a report form a residence in Hillsboro that she had received a check from Resilite Sports Products, Inc. informing her that she had won out of a random drawing from UK and North American Shopper Sweepstakes. The only thing she was to do was to send the tax fee back to them. This is a scam trying to get money from the elderly.
